## Sensor Drift — Who to Contact

The Verdantry greenhouse controller's humidity probes drift roughly 2% per month and are recalibrated on the first Monday of each cycle. If readings diverge more than 5% from the reference sensor, file a calibration ticket and note the bay number. Firmware-level drift (affecting all bays simultaneously) goes to the controls team instead. For calibration scheduling and drift history, reach out here.

billing contact of tahaf-kafop = istwyn_fraox@norvaworks.corp

Visitor Policy — Basement Archive: Visitors to the Torvik & Sand archive room (Basement Level 1) must be accompanied by a staff member at all times. New starters count as staff only after completing records training. No bags, food, or pens inside; pencils are provided at the door. The archive door locks automatically behind you. Escorting staff should use the current door code shown below.

door code, yagap-bahof: bdg-O-05

## Deployment

The Furrowtrace gateway collects telemetry from combine harvesters across the Melder Valley co-op and forwards it to the central yield service. Deploys go through the orchard-deploy pipeline; do not push binaries by hand. Each release is staged on one depot node for 24 hours before fleet rollout. After deploying, confirm the heartbeat dashboard shows all field units reporting within five minutes. The gateway reads its settings from a single file at startup, reproduced here for reference.

settings of tagef-bawif:
DRUIX_HOST=druix.zemvarlabs.internal
DRUIX_PORT=8000

Finance Review Summary — Quarterly, Ostrel Manufacturing

Customer concentration remains elevated: our top account, Brindlevale Systems, represents 38% of revenue, up from 31% last year. Loss or renegotiation of this account would materially affect cash flow. Sales leads are asked to prioritise pipeline diversification and report new-logo progress monthly. Mitigation measures are under discussion with the executive team. The agreed plan appears below.

confidential, yagep-kagef: Rusvanox Holdings is in early talks to buy Julwynix Systems for about $454.5 million. The Fenael launch date is April 23, and nothing goes to the press before then. Legal wants the Druwynix Works term sheet redrafted before January 8.